Capital One Cafés are part bank, part café–all in one place. Everyone’s welcome, whether you bank with us or not. Come in for everyday banking and in-person support from Ambassadors. Café ATMs are fee-free for Capital One Checking account holders to get cash, deposit cash or checks, or check their balance. Enjoy world-class coffee from Verve Coffee Roasters and an all-day food menu. Get 50% off handcrafted beverages every day when paying with a Capital One or Discover debit or credit card. Settle in and enjoy free Wi-Fi and comfortable spaces for working, meeting or taking a break. You can even work toward money goals with free-for-everyone financial literacy events and workshops. Frequently Asked Questions About Capital One Café

What is a Capital One Café?

A Capital One Café is part bank, part café–all in one convenient and welcoming space. Come in for everyday banking, in-person support from Ambassadors and handcrafted beverages from Verve Coffee Roasters. The Café offers free WiFi and cozy seating for all, plus most of our locations have extended and weekend hours. You can even work toward your money goals with free events, workshops and one-on-one Money & Life mentoring. Visit any of our 60+ locations nationwide whether you bank with us or not. Everyone’s welcome.

Can I come to a Capital One Café if I’m not a customer?

Whether you bank with us or not, everyone is welcome to come in for coffee, relax and recharge at our 55+ Cafés across the nation. Every Capital One Café location is truly a community space that offers both financial and social events to support your everyday well-being.
